Manufacturer: Honeywell

Part Number: HS8206BA4K

Specifications:

  • Type: Hall Effect Sensor
  • Operating Voltage: 4.5V to 24V DC
  • Output Type: Digital (Open Collector)
  • Output Current: 25mA (max)
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+125°C
  • Switching Frequency: Up to 20kHz
  • Magnetic Sensitivity: Bipolar (responds to both North and South poles)
  • Package Type: SOT-23 (Surface Mount)

Descriptions:

The HS8206BA4K is a high-performance Hall Effect sensor designed for digital position sensing applications. It provides a reliable open-collector output that switches in response to magnetic fields, making it suitable for speed detection, proximity sensing, and rotary encoding.

Features:

  • Bipolar Operation: Detects both North and South magnetic poles.
  • Wide Voltage Range: Operates from 4.5V to 24V DC.
  • High Temperature Tolerance: Functions reliably in extreme conditions (-40°C to +125°C).
  • Fast Response Time: Supports switching frequencies up to 20kHz.
  • Robust Design: Resistant to mechanical stress and vibration.
  • Compact Form Factor: SOT-23 package for space-constrained applications.

This sensor is commonly used in autom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ics for precise magnetic field detection.
